Merry Harmony Display Font for Festive Editorial Design

Merry Harmony is a festive bold display font designed to bring warmth, joy, and holiday spirit into your creative projects. Featuring rounded letterforms, soft inner-line detailing, and a cheerful han, this typeface offers a unique visual personality that stands out in crowded digital feeds and printed publications alike. For editorial designers and content creators who rely on strong typography to guide reader attention, Merry Harmony provides an instant mood setter that elevates seasonal content from ordinary to exceptional.

Merry Harmony Pairing Strategies for Balanced Layouts

Effective editorial design relies on harmonious font pairings that balance decoration with readability. While Merry Harmony is a powerful display font, it should not be used alone for extended reading. To create a balanced layout, pair Merry Harmony with a highly readable serif font for body text or a clean sans serif font for captions and navigation elements. A classic serif font complements the traditional feel of Merry Harmony, creating a cohesive look for literary or academic holiday content. Conversely, a modern sans serif font provides a contemporary contrast, suitable for tech-savvy audiences or minimalist design aesthetics. These combinations allow the designer to maintain visual interest while ensuring that the core content remains accessible.
